General annotation (Comments)
| Function | Transfers sialic acid from the donor of substrate CMP-sialic acid to galactose containing acceptor substrates. Has alpha-2,6-sialyltransferase activity toward oligosaccharides that have the Gal-beta-1,4-GlcNAc sequence at the non-reducing end of their carbohydrate groups, but it has weak or no activities toward glycoproteins and glycolipids. |
| Catalytic activity | CMP-N-acetylneuraminate + beta-D-galactosyl-1,4-N-acetyl-beta-D-glucosamine = CMP + alpha-N-acetylneuraminyl-2,6-beta-D-galactosyl-1,4-N-acetyl-beta-D-glucosamine. Ref.1 Ref.6 Ref.7 |
| Subcellular location | Golgi apparatus › Golgi stack membrane; Single-pass type II membrane protein By similarity. |
| Tissue specificity | Weakly expressed in some tissues, such as small intestine, colon and fetal brain. Ref.1 Ref.6 |
| Induction | By IL6/interleukin-6 and IL8//interleukin-8. Ref.8 |
| Post-translational modification | O-glycosylated. Ref.9 |
| Sequence similarities | Belongs to the glycosyltransferase 29 family. |
| Biophysicochemical properties | Kinetic parameters: KM=0.74 mM for Gal-beta-1,4-GlcNAc-beta-O-octyl Ref.1 Ref.6 KM=0.71 mM for Gal-beta-1,4-GlcNAc KM=0.48 mM for lacto-N-neotetraose |
